Circuit Breakers - JLE-2-1-53-3-B4-250-A-V Application Field and Working Principle

Circuit breakers are electrical devices used to detect and isolate faults and to protect equipment and wiring systems from overcurrents. They are designed to react quickly to dangerous faults in an electrical system, in order to minimize the impact of an event.
